Being Geek: Career Strategies to Stay a Geek is a book written by a geek, and while the title includes 'geek', it offers valuable insights for any engineer.
The author's perspective and way of expressing ideas may have a unique style, but it is certainly informative.
I really like this book and consider it one that I want to keep on hand.